Creeping up on the 800 km mark and my wife is away this weekend on some girls trip so I will spend some time doing some maintenance. I normally use Amsoil 0-40 Synthetic in my toys but was at Canadian tire today and they had Mobil 1 4.4L jugs at over $18 off. I bought a couple of jugs of the European Car Formula 0-40. Anyone have any issues or opinions on this? I use Mobil 1 in my trucks religiously and have never had a problem. Look forward to the feedback. If it is no good I can take it back.

As I have read elsewhere on TY ... modern Energy Conserving automotive oils lack additives that ARE present in that oil, making it quite suitable for our sleds. Lots of opinions of course but the bottom line is that many knowledgeable members here use and endorse Mobil 1 European Formula.
